首页 > 技术文章 > 如何给cbv的程序添加装饰器

duanlinxiao 2019-02-18 14:49 原文

引入method_decorator模块

1,直接在类上加装饰器

@method_decorator(test,name=‘dispatch’)

class Loginview(view)

2,直接在处理的函数前加装饰器

@method_decorator(test)

  def post(self,request,*args,**kwargs):

    pass

推荐阅读